#3b9184 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b9184 is composed of 23.1% red, 56.9%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 9%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 170.9 degrees, a saturation of 42.2% and a lightness of 40%. #3b9184 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#002309.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#3b9184
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020605 is the darkest color, while #f7fcfb is the lightest one.
